Samsung reveals Exynos 2600: world's first 2nm smartphone chip could supercharge Galaxy S26
techspot - The Exynos 2600, manufactured by Samsung Foundry, features a 10-core configuration based on Arm's v9.3 architecture. It uses the new C1-Ultra (prime) and C1-Pro (middle) cores – Samsung has dropped the low-power cores in this Exynos model.Read Entire Arti…

Meta and Arm Forge Strategic AI Partnership
Meta Platforms and Arm Holdings have announced a strategic collaboration aimed at boosting AI performance and energy efficiency. The partnership will integrate Arm’s advanced, energy-saving technologies into Meta’s systems as the companies seek to optimize AI workloads and scale up their technological ambitions.
